AUSTRALIAN

Sydney, July 17. Butler asked the]] authorities to write to Preston's parents, and express his, sorrow and contrition at tne murder df their son. The Westraliau police inform the authorities' here that they are certain Butler committed the series of crimes known a3 the Budock murders. Dr Lamb, the New Hebrides missionary, has been advised not to visit Nevr Zealand at present. He spends a couple of f months in Queensland. A horse and buggy bolted in Main street, Newcastle, and killed a young iady named Claxtbu, and seriously injured 3 boys. MELBOURNE, July 17\ The committee appointed to report on, tho financial prdposals of the Federation Draft Bill as far as Victoria is concerned report the inequalities as apparently caused by the Bill, owing to the varying circumstances of the colonies, could be nearly all adjusted by £Jhe Federal Parliament in such ia way as to d o justice to all the States. The main factor in solving difficulties is an uniform tariff, which could be so framed as to neutralise the losses arid gains .of each S^ate. Mr Mathieson, Railway Oomiriisidrier, fur-: nishes a memo with reference to the railway proposals. He advises conditions should be made absolute that the whole if any, of the Victorian system should be transferred to the Federal at capital cost. Revised rules will be submitted at the annual meeting of the Victoria Racing Club to make' it coiripuis'ory that all horses be ridden out to the end of the race. Jockeys in future are not to own horses. Should a bookmaker have any interest in a H6rsb it stiall bo. raced in the! names qf all person^ having, any interest therein. When a trainer is disqualified all horses in his stables ard not placed under the ban, only those which the trainer can be proved to be interested in. The powers of stewards arc generally eqlarged,. Brisbane, July 18. Obituary—Rev. Isaac Harding, the oldest Wesleyan Minister ot Australia. He formerly resided iv New Zealand.
